Notes |
- William Preston was an old army friend of Meriwether Lewis. They were also fellow speculators in Kentucky lands. Lewis had written a long letter date 25 July 1808 discussing his glimpses of life and emotion. (See additional information about this letter in Notes for Letitia Breckenridge.)
William Preston had just recently married Miss Hancock, an older sister of Julia Hancock, William Clark's wife.
